Cell Membrane A novel coronavirus has recently been identified as the causative agent of SARS (Severe Acute Respiratory Syndrome). Coronaviruses are a major cause of upper respiratory diseases in humans. The genomes of these viruses are positive stranded RNA approximately 27 to 31kb in length. SARS infection can be mediated by the binding of the viral spike protein a glycosylated 139 kDa protein and the major surface antigen of the virus to the angiotensin converting enzyme 2 (ACE2) on target cells. This binding can be blocked by a soluble form of ACE2. The evelope protein is a component of the viral envelope that plays a central role in virus morphogenesis and assembly. It may be sufficient to form virus like particles.
Function:
Component of the viral envelope that plays a central role in virus morphogenesis and assembly. It is sufficient to form virus-like particles. Seems to be important for creating the membrane curvature needed to acquire the rounded stable and infectious particle phenotype. Acts as a viroporin inducing the formation of hydrophilic pores in cellular membranes. Also induces apoptosis (By similarity).
Subunit:
Homooligomer. Interacts with the M membrane protein in the budding compartment of the host cell which is located between endoplasmic reticulum and the Golgi complex (By similarity). Interacts with the accessory proteins 3a and 7a.
Subcellular Location:
Virion membrane; Single-pass type III membrane protein (Potential). Golgi apparatus membrane; Single-pass type III membrane protein (Potential). Note=Largely membrane-embedded. The N-terminus could be located within the membrane near the cytoplasmic side since no part of the protein is aparently exposed on the virion outside. The large hydrophobic domain could form a hairpin looping back through the membrane. There also may be a second hydrophobic domain integrated into membranes (By similarity).
Similarity:
Belongs to the coronaviruses E protein family.
